Jonathan Clay is a young musician in his 20's. His music has been featured on television shows, Lincoln Heights, The Hills, and the Real World. His sound is similar to Gavin DeGraw. This One's for Me is a very catchy song, featuring great guitar licks. He shows off his beautiful lyrics in songs, Back to Good, After All and Wonderful. Ferras, is a piano playing singer, songwriter. His song, Hollywood's not America, was featured on American Idol last season. He's been referred to as baby Elton (Elton John) and listening to his piano play on the album, you can see why. Take My Lips and Soul Rock are silky and smooth. Hollywood's not America is a bona fide hit that I could listen to repeatedly. Ferras' album, Aliens & Rainbows, is available on itunes and at wal-mart and target. Eric Hutchinson is, a fun young singer, songwriter. He's enjoying some success with his song, Rock n Roll. The album, Sounds like Something, contains several upbeat songs with great beats. It's Alright with Me is a very fun song as is, All Over Now. Hutchinson's music has the power to cure your blues and it's understandable that he's drawn comparison to Jason Mraz.
